A professional, independent wrestler out of the Philly area, 18 years young and as is the all proclaimed Prophet of Pro Wrestling. His finishing maneuver the "Ginger Snap" pays homage to his Auburn locks.
Jon Newcomer is going to make his opponent tap to the snap
by Ahhhhh to the Naaaaa January 13, 2011